Welcome to the Kinabatangan River, Sabah's longest river and one of Borneo's most important wildlife habitats. This ancient rainforest ecosystem consists of riverine forests, wetlands, and floodplains that support an incredible diversity of wildlife.
Evening cruise offers the best opportunity to observe animals as they become active before sunset. Look out for the iconic Proboscis Monkey, macaques, hornbills, kingfishers, monitor lizards, and crocodiles along the riverbanks. With some luck, you may also spot the endangered Bornean Orangutan or the rare Bornean Pygmy Elephant.
The Kinabatangan serves as a vital wildlife corridor, providing food, water, and shelter for countless species. Every tree, plant, bird, and animal plays an important role in maintaining the balance of this unique ecosystem.
